Description

Deep blue lupine flowers frame both sides of this exquisite Edwardian Easter greeting card, where a charming rabbit emerges from a cracked green egg adorned with a beaded purple garland and blue flowers at its base. Delicate chicks appear at the top corner and bottom left, creating a whimsical springtime scene. The rabbit's ears are rendered with fine detail against an olive-green background panel, demonstrating the skilled chromolithographic techniques of the era. The ornate text reading 'An Easter Greeting' completes this delightful celebration of renewal and nature's awakening.
